how much water do dandelions need

Dandelions need a lot of water to thrive, so plan to water them regularly. However, do not water them too much. Water just enough so that the soil feels moist. Check the soil by poking your finger into it once every 2 to 3 days.

How much sun does a dandelions need?

If you're growing dandelions for their foliage only, they'll tolerate soil in poorer physical condition. They prefer full sun but will do fine in partial shade. Plant seeds directly in the garden 1/4 inch deep in single rows or wide rows.

Are dandelions easy to grow?

Every part of the plant can be used, they're easy to grow, and they're even attractive. All you have to do is get past the negative associations with them. If you're willing to try growing something new in your garden, make it dandelions. The leaves are delicious in salads and are a fine substitute for spinach.

Does dandelions need sun or shade?

Hardy to zone 3, dandelions grow in sun or shade, but for better tasting greens a partial to full shade location is ideal. The best soil for dandelion seed growing is characteristically rich, fertile, well-draining, slightly alkaline and soft down to 10 inches (25 cm.)
